Resideo, in a February 17, 2025, announcement, declared the end-of-life (EOL) for its first-generation Total Connect 2.0-compatible cameras. These cameras will no longer function with the TC2 platform after July 31, 2025. Resideo recommends replacing them promptly for uninterrupted service.

The following cameras and accessories are affected by this notice:

The VX Series cameras from Resideo are now available for use with Total Connect 2.0, providing a significant upgrade in performance and features. Improvements include enhanced image resolution and quality, sophisticated AI event detection (allowing for more precise alerts), and integrated two-way audio functionality.

The VX Series doesn't directly replace some older camera equipment. Specifically, it lacks replacements for the first-generation pan-tilt camera, the ACU (analog converter unit), and the WAP-Plus access point. If you need to replace these older devices, Resideo suggests using one or more VX5 indoor cameras in place of the IP-CAM PT/IP-CAM PT2. Cameras currently connected to ACUs should also be replaced with the appropriate VX Series camera.

Recommended VX Series Replacements for Cameras at EOL:
Product Name Recommended
Replacement
IPCAM-WI VX5 Indoor Camera
IPCAM-WI2 VX5 Indoor Camera
IPCAM-WL VX5 Indoor Camera
IPCAM-WO VX3 Outdoor Camera
IPCAM-PT/IPCAM-PT2/PT2A One or More VX5 Indoor Cameras
ACU Replace ACU and Camera with appropriate Indoor or Outdoor VX5 Camera
AP/WAP-PLUS/WREX No Replacement Available

In an email last week, Johnson Controls, the parent company of Qolsys, announced the discontinuation of both the Qolsys IQ WIFI and the Qolsys IQ WIFI 6. These purpose-built routers, accessible via Alarm.com, were meant to prevent security equipment disconnections due to end-user errors.


We first told you about the IQ WIFI 6 in October 2022. It offered an elegant solution for users with security systems. The IQ WIFI 6, designed to act as the router while IQ WIFI units functioned as Wi-Fi nodes, created a mesh network with a unique security partition accessible only by the alarm dealer.

This, combined with remote access through Alarm.com, prevented costly service calls when customers made changes to their network, then inadvertently neglected to update their security system components.

Unfortunately, it didn't catch on. End-users interested enough in their network to invest in a specialized router prioritized optimizing their network for gaming or streaming video, rather than ensuring reliable connectivity for their security systems and WIFI cameras.


If you own an IQ WIFI 6, rest assured it will continue to function as usual. Alarm.com has pledged ongoing support, allowing dealers to remotely access and troubleshoot internet connectivity for your system. The IQ WIFI is not accessible through Alarm.com, so with the end-of-sales notice, they will no longer offer live setup support for the IQ WIFI.

Alarm Grid has discontinued both the IQ WIFI and IQ WIFI 6 on our website. We do not maintain stock, and our distributor has very limited inventory available. To avoid accepting orders that we cannot fulfill, we have decided to discontinue both products immediately.

Resideo announced today that the final Lynx product still being manufactured is discontinued, effective immediately. Some components required to produce the LynxTouch L5210 panel are obsolete, so the decision has been made to move on. Rest in peace LynxTouch. You were a good product.

At that time, in early 2001, the Lynx panel lineup was their only wireless all-in-one panel. Its competition was the Simon panel lineup from ITI/Interlogix/GE. Both manufacturers' panels spoke, and both spoke with a female voice. For a person who didn't have any experience with wiring or resistors, it was like an oasis in a desert of hardwired panels. The Lynx could be a bear to program because it didn't have an actual alpha display, but nearly every Lynx panel in use was exclusively using wireless sensors.

Resideo announced last week that due to a required component becoming obsolete, they are forced to discontinue the popular 5800FLOOD sensor. There is still some available stock, so Alarm Grid has not yet discontinued it, but once all stock has been exhausted, the 5800FLOOD is gone for good.

The 5800FLOOD is popular because unlike the 5821, it doesn't require that a water probe be added to the sensor. Water detection is built-in, and configuration is easy. Another benefit of the 5800FLOOD is that it will alert for flooding more quickly than the 5821. The prongs of the 5800FLOOD need only be in contact with water for about 25 seconds before a signal is sent to the alarm panel. The 5821 flood probe must be in contact with water for about three (3) minutes before sending a signal.

In addition to flood sensing, the 5800FLOOD also monitors for extreme cold and/or hot temperatures locally. This is done using a temperature sensor that is built into the 5800FLOOD. For cold temperature sensing, if the ambient temperature drops below 45℉ (7.2℃) for more than 15 minutes, an alert is sent using Loop 1. For high-temperature sensing, if the temperature rises above 95℉ (35℃) for more than 15 minutes, then an alert is sent using Loop 2. The flood sensor transmits using Loop 3.

Now that the 5800FLOOD is being discontinued, the Resideo and Honeywell Home 5821 is the recommended replacement. One drawback to the 5821 is that it requires a remote probe be added for flood sensing, and for freeze sensing. However, only one (1) remote probe can be used per transmitter, so if you need to monitor for both flood and freeze, two (2) 5821s are required.

The 5821 supports the following functions:

Loop Number Sensing Capability Description
Loop 1 Ambient Low Temperature Sensing <45℉ (7.2℃) >10 Minutes sends alert
Loop 2 - Local Ambient Warm/Hot Temperature Sensing >75℉ (23.8℃) >10 Minutes sends alert; >95℉ (35℃) >10 minutes sends alert. Disabled when any remote probe is used!
Loop 2 - Remote Using T280R or TS300R Remote Probe Freeze Sensing >10℉ (-12.2℃) for 30 minutes; Refrigerator Sensing >42℉ (5.5℃) for 30 minutes. Can't be used if the Flood Probe is used.
Loop 3 - Remote Uses FP280 or 470PB Remote Probe Flood Sensing - Signals when the probe's terminals have been in contact with at least 1/4" of water for > 3 Minutes. Can't be used if the Temp Probe is used.

For flood sensing, we recommend using the FP280 as it includes wiring, and the required resistor is already in place. With the 470PB, the user is responsible for providing their own wire and must add the 2.2 MΩ resistor themselves. In all cases, wiring between the 5821 and whichever remote probe is used should be made as short as possible, and should not exceed 96" (243cm). Effective in August of 2022, Alarm.com is ending sales of Alarm.Com Image Sensors (ADC-IS-220-GC and ADC-IS-300-LP). Alarm Grid has already discontinued these sensors due to the fact that they are in short supply, and no more of them will be produced. Only the Honeywell Home PROINDMV remains.

The 2GIG IMAGE3:


There was some overlap between the Alarm.com Image Sensor models, and the 2GIG and Qolsys Image Sensor models. I have confirmed with Alarm.com that the 2GIG and Qolsys models are also discontinued as of August, 2022. Currently, the only Image Sensors being offered by Alarm Grid are the DSC PowerG and Honeywell Home PROINDMV models which are discussed in more detail below.

Image sensors were a great idea that never really took off. The original image sensors, first offered by 2GIG and Alarm.com, did not have particularly good resolution or picture quality, which is probably one reason they weren't widely adopted by the DIY crowd. By the time the 2nd generation of these sensors came around, people were prepared to simply go with full-on video monitoring or to avoid capturing images altogether.

Both the second and third-generation image sensors that were offered by 2GIG, Qolsys, and Alarm.com had very good image quality. Combine that with Alarm Grid's policy of offering monitoring for image sensors without an additional price markup, and the image sensor was a viable alternative to the use of video cameras. An Alarm.com user could log into their account and perform a "peek-in", meaning they could request that a particular image sensor grab a picture of whatever it was able to see at that moment, and the image (actually two (2) images) would then be uploaded to the customer's alarm.com account for viewing. The sensor could also take images upon sensing motion after a particular period of inactivity, or upon an alarm. For full details on image sensor features and operation, check out this prior post.

DSC offers a couple of PowerG PIR Cameras that will work with the Qolsys IQ Panel 2 and IQ Panel 4 in addition to the DSC PowerSeries Neo panels with a PowerG Transceiver added. These are the DSC PG9934P, Indoor PIR Camera, and the DSC PG9944, Outdoor PIR Camera. These sensors work like any other PowerG Sensor with the Qolsys Panels. They can only capture images when the system is armed and the image sensor is active (not bypassed). They send their images to the panel, and then the first image is uploaded to Alarm.com. A total of ten (10) images are taken, and these images are stitched together by the panel into a sort of stop-motion video where each image can also be viewed individually. This is done via the panel screen itself. When used with the PowerSeries Neo panels, the DSC PIR Cameras can be used for Visual Verification only, they do NOT work like a regular image sensor with Alarm.com.

The Honeywell Home PROINDMV is a wireless PIR motion sensor with a camera built-in, just like the 2GIG, Qolsys, and Alarm.com image sensors were. The PROINDMV is currently only supported on the Resideo PROA7PLUSC, and Honeywell Home PROA7PLUS panels. There is no "peek-in" option for these image sensors. They can only capture images when they sense motion while the system is armed in Away mode. Images or videos are captured and uploaded to Total Connect 2.0 for viewing. The user can choose to receive either a still image or a 10-second video clip. You can read their full details of operation in our previous post.

Resideo sent out a notice on March 16 that the Lynx 3000 and the LynxTouch 7000, (aka the L3000 and the L7000) are discontinued. The Lynx Touch 5210 (L5210) is still being manufactured. This marks the end of an era for this product line as there is now no push-button panel option available.

Alarm Grid has already discontinued the L3000 panel because there are none in stock. There are some L7000 panels in inventory, so you can still purchase one of those panels, for now. However, as soon as stock is exhausted the L7000 will also be history. Speaking of history, the Lynx panel has had quite a run. The original Lynx panel was released in the 1990s and didn't even have a rechargeable battery.

The next iteration, the Lynx-R (R for Rechargeable), came along very soon after the Lynx (for obvious reasons). Then the LynxR-24, the LynxR-EN. There were so many different versions over the next 20 years. It used to be quite a job just figuring out which Lynx panel someone had when they needed support! It wasn't always a requirement that you know the version in order to solve the issue, but at times, the version information was crucial.

In the early 2010s the LynxTouch panels came along with the introduction of the LynxTouch L5000. That panel was missing some key features. It couldn't support any type of internet communication. It didn't have a back door into programming, so if you lost the Installer Code, well, that was too bad. So, pretty soon the L5100 was released with desirable features included that were missing in the L5000. We have an entire video devoted to discussing the versions of the LynxTouch panels, their differences, and how you can tell them apart.

Now, we're saying goodbye to the Lynx 3000, and the LynxTouch L7000. Since the first Lynx panel was introduced nearly 30 years ago, this is the first time there is no push-button version of a Lynx available. These panels have been very popular in apartments and dormitories, and I'm sure they will be missed. They are being replaced by the Honeywell Home PROA7, the Resideo PROA7C, the Honeywell Home PROA7PLUS, or the Resideo PROA7PLUSC.

The Lynx lineup is not completely gone, though. The Resideo LynxTouch 5210 (L5210) is still being manufactured. This panel occupies the middle ground between the L3000 and the L7000. It has a touchscreen, though it is rather small at 4.3 inches. It offers nearly all the same features as the L7000, albeit fewer of them. This means fewer zones, and fewer users in addition to the smaller screen, but also a smaller price tag. Check out this comparison between the L7000 and the L5210. Qolsys TSB #211022 indicates that the Qolsys IQ Panel 2 Plus, PowerG and 319.5 MHz version with any communicator has been discontinued. All kits containing these versions have also been discontinued. The IQ Panel 4 PowerG and 319.5 MHz panel is the appropriate replacement in this instance.

Currently Alarm Grid offers the Qolsys IQ Panel 4 Verizon LTE, Interlogix/GE Compatible 319.5 MHz Wireless Alarm Panel w/ PowerG, and the Qolsys IQ Panel 4 AT&T LTE, Interlogix/GE Compatible 319.5 MHz Wireless Alarm Panel w/ PowerG. Both versions will eventually be offered in Black or White color variations, but at this time only the White variation is available.

This announcement is only for the Interlogix/GE compatible panels that support legacy RF in the 319.5 MHz frequency. The other variations of the IQ Panel 2 Plus, those that support 345 MHz Honeywell and 2GIG legacy RF, and 433 MHz DSC legacy RF sensors are still available at this time. This is because production for the IQ Panel 4 versions of these panels has not yet begun.

Per Qolsys, the IQ Panel 4 PowerG and Honeywell/2GIG compatible panels that support 345 MHz legacy RF sensors are beginning production this week. As supply ramps up, the Qolsys IQ Panel 2 Plus that supports this legacy RF frequency will be phased out. We expect this to begin happening in the near future. Production of the IQ Panel 4 for the DSC compatible panels that support 433 MHz legacy RF sensors will begin production in early December, with a similar phase out of those IQ Panel 2 Plus models soon to follow.

As with the IQ Panel 2 Plus, each Qolsys IQ Panel 4 will support PowerG in addition to one (1) legacy RF frequency. In addition to choosing a panel based on the RF frequency to be used, the user will also want to choose the panel with the built-in cellular communicator that will have the best signal strength and quality in the location where the panel will be installed. This can match the carrier for the user's cell phone, but that is not a requirement. When deciding which cellular carrier to choose, base the decision solely on cellular coverage. Billing for the panel's cellular communicator will be included in the monthly monitoring service charges.

The legacy RF frequency built-in to the IQ Panel 4 is intended to make it easy to replace an existing alarm panel from a different manufacturer. By choosing the IQ Panel 4 that supports the wireless frequency for sensors that are already installed in a location, a user can save a lot of money by not having to buy all new sensors. You get the benefit of an all new, feature-rich alarm panel without the expense, not to mention the time and trouble saved, of replacing existing sensors that still work.

Alarm.com announced on Friday, October 22, 2021 that they plan to discontinue sales of the Concord 4 Dual-Path VoLTE Module and Gateway at the end of October. Interlogix, which is now owned by UTC (United Technologies Corporation) stopped making the Concord 4 panel in late 2019.

There were two (2) VoLTE Dual-Path communicators formerly offered by Alarm.com. The Alarm.com CD-411-US-AT AT&T LTE version, and the Alarm.com CD-421-US-VZ Verizon LTE version. Both of these modules have been on backorder for some time during the global chip shortage, which may have played a part in the decision to discontinue them.

As of now, there is still a Verizon LTE cellular-only communicator available for the Concord 4 panel. The Interlogix GE 600-1053-LTE-VZ connects to the Verizon LTE network for fast and reliable delivery of alarm signals and Alarm.com notifications. With Alarm.com service, the user also has the ability to review status and send alarm system commands remotely using the Alarm.com app or website.

UPDATE 10/26/21! We've discovered that the Interlogix GE 600-1053-LTE-VZ is not available from any of our vendors. We haven't seen an official discontinuation notice, but it seems it may have been. This means that currently, we can't offer any new LTE communicators for the Interlogix/GE Concord 4. For alarm reporting only, the Resideo LTEM-PA or LTEM-PV with the Resideo PRODCM Dialer Capture Module can be used.

The Concord 4 panel is not one that Alarm Grid sells. However, for those users with a Concord 4 in the field that is still working just fine, an updated communicator allows them to continue using a system they're comfortable with, while taking advantage of newly introduced features.

With a subscription to Alarm.com and one of the Verizon LTE communicators, not only can the user view the status of their system, arm and disarm remotely, and receive text, email, or push notifications on alarm events, but they can also add the convenience of Z-Wave functionality to the system. Z-Wave is a communications protocol that allows various devices in your home or business to communicate with the main system to do things such as turn on lights, set the thermostat to a particular temperature based on a Geo-Fence or on the armed status of the panel, and many more options. The Concord 4 panel just needs to be on version 4.0 or higher to support the use of the 600-1053-LTE-VZ communicator.

We've actually heard this before. In December of 2020, we reported that Alarm.com would begin phasing out support for Edge Legacy in February of 2021, with support for that browser ending in April. However, apparently, those plans were thwarted and the new deadline is now on the horizon.

So, what is Edge Legacy, anyway? Well, when Windows 10 first launched back in 2015, Edge Legacy, then called Microsoft Edge was a part of that browser package in the same way that Internet Explorer had always been a part of the prior Windows releases. The original Edge was a HTML-based browser that Microsoft hoped would change the game for them, however, it was universally panned. I think I speak for everyone when I say, "Hated it!"

In January, 2020, Microsoft re-launched Microsoft Edge. This new version is built on Chromium, which is an open-source browser platform that was originally launched by Google, and serves as the backbone of Google Chrome as well as Opera, and Vivaldi. Since it's open-source, anyone can take it and make what they want with it.

Now that Microsoft has "embraced" Chromium, all modern browsers use open-source base platforms. Also, the use of Chromium means that the new Edge works with Chrome extensions. One of the big changes with Microsoft Edge is that it gets updated regularly and automatically, as opposed to updates being rolled out bundled with Windows updates. Microsoft stopped supporting Edge Legacy as of March 9, 2021.

So, back to Alarm.com and their announcement. Beginning Monday November 1, 2021, if a user logs into Alarm.com using either the Edge Legacy or the Internet Explorer 11 (IE11) browser, they will receive a pop-up message suggesting that they switch to a more up-to-date browser. They will continue to be able to log in using the current browser for the next two (2) months. After two (2) months, January 1, 2022, Edge Legacy and IE11 will no longer be supported for use with Alarm.com.

It is suggested that users choose Google Chrome, Mozilla Firefox, Apple Safari, or Microsoft Edge (the newest version) when accessing Alarm.com. Any of these compatible browsers on the most current version should provide a good, quality user experience when using Alarm.com. Frequent readers of our blog may remember from back in late March of this year that the Honeywell IPCAM-WOC1, also called the Lyric OC1, was discontinued without replacement. However, we may soon be reversing that statement, as we have heard that the outdoor camera may soon return!

If you are not familiar with the Honeywell IPCAM-WOC1, it is an outdoor security camera that is used with the Total Connect 2.0 interactive security notification and automation platform. It was quite shocking to us when the camera was discontinued, as it left no outdoor camera available for use with the TC2 platform. Nevertheless, we reported the news, and we even mentioned that it left the door open for a new camera to be revealed at ISC West 2021.

However, Resideo experts have stated that the Honeywell IPCAM-WOC1 was never really discontinued completely, and it was actually just being made temporarily unavailable due to supply issues. Once Resideo resolves the supply issues, the Honeywell IPCAM-WOC1 will supposedly be making a triumphant return. According to insider sources, such a return would not happen until September. It's still a couple months away, but a return might be a reality!

Please understand though, this is just a rumor at this time, albeit one with some very credible sources. We have also heard from our inside sources that it's possible that the Honeywell IPCAM-WOC1 may return as an updated model, with perhaps even a different part number. This would make sense, as the IPCAM-WOC1 was known for being a somewhat quirky device. An update to improve its performance upon return would certainly be appreciated.
